Chicago Bears safeties M.D. Jennings and Ryan Mundy lined up as the starting safeties Tuesday, May 27, at organized team activities (OTAs) with FS Chris Conte (shoulder) still recovering from offseason shoulder surgery.
Footballguys view: Jennings ended up underwhelming in Green Bay and Mundy is thought to be a better third safety, but with the departure of Major Wright and Chris Conte's awful play against the run last year, the Bears will try anything to see if they can improve the safety position. |

Green Bay Packers S Sean Richardson, who played this weekend in his third game since coming off neck surgery, replaced starter M.D. Jennings in the second quarter and impressed the Packers enough that they want to at least give him more playing time against the Dallas Cowboys. "Very aggressive," Packers coach Mike McCarthy said. "I liked what he did on defense. Sean brings an attitude, energy, juice. So he may get some more opportunities this week."

Green Bay Packers FS M.D. Jennings will start at free safety in the team's Week 5 game, and there are no plans to rotate anyone into the lineup. 'M.D.'s earned it,' said Darren Perry, who coaches the safeties. 'M.D. has been more consistent than all of them. He's made plays. He's been consistent in his tackling.'

Green Bay Packers safeties coach Darren Perry said he does not think FS M.D. Jennings or SS Jerron McMillian have an edge for the starting safety job next to FS Morgan Burnett. 'I don't think either one of those guys separated themselves in terms of being 'that guy' at the end of the last season,' Darren Perry said. 'They both made strides and I think they're going to be fine football players, I really do. But in terms of who distinguishes themselves as 'the guy,' we're just going to have to wait and see and enjoy the competition.'
